webhr banner

How to choose HR Software?

Discover how to choose HR Software. Compare HRIS, HCM, and HRMS for your Human Resources needs and make an informed decision on the right system.

content image

A survey shows 94% of HR pros felt stressed recently. About 88% don't look forward to work. With so many people changing jobs lately, HR teams are super busy and 97% are feeling wiped out from all the extra work this past year.

But with the right technology, you as a HR Professional can be saved from the Great Resignation. HR Software solutions can help you out by automating your daily and recurring HR processes. Before coming to the point of “How to choose an HR System”, let’s discuss HR Software and its types,

What is HR Software?

HR Software is a set of modules, that can simplify and automate HR Processes and operations. Mainly, HR System like WebHR uses technology to streamline HR management, significantly cut down on paperwork, simplify recurring  HR tasks, and help HR professionals focus on more key tasks that really matter. However, some common names come up while searching for HR Solutions to choose from,

Types of HR Software

  • Human Resource Management System (HRMS)
  • Human Resource Information System (HRIS)
  • Human Capital Management (HCM)

HRMS, HRIS, and HCM

Human Resource Management System (HRMS)

An HRMS functions as a comprehensive tool, integrating various aspects of workforce management into a single platform. It streamlines and automates processes like payroll, benefits administration, and performance tracking, providing a centralized database for all employee information.

Key features include employee self-service, payroll and benefits management, time and attendance tracking, performance management, and recruitment processes. These software features are designed to enhance HR operational efficiency.

The primary benefits of an HRMS include improved data accuracy, enhanced compliance with labor laws, time-saving through automation, and better employee engagement through self-service portals. It also aids in strategic decision-making by providing detailed analytics and reports.

Human Resource Information System (HRIS)

An HRIS is a software system designed to manage people, policies, and procedures. It serves as a repository for employee data and facilitates the management of HR processes, often offering reporting and analytics capabilities.

Essential features of an HRIS include employee data management, time and attendance, payroll, benefits administration, and sometimes talent management. These features are integral to streamlining HR administrative tasks.

Benefits of using an HRIS include enhanced data management and accuracy, efficient handling of HR tasks, improved regulatory compliance, and better workforce insights through analytics. It also facilitates easier access to employee information, helping in strategic planning and decision-making.

Human Capital Management (HCM)

HCM is a holistic approach that views employees as assets whose value can be enhanced through strategic investment and management. It encompasses all HR functions, integrating them into an overarching strategic framework that aligns with organizational goals.

HCM systems typically include advanced features like talent management, workforce planning, learning and development, succession planning, and comprehensive analytics. These are often supplemented with AI-driven insights for better decision-making.

The benefits of an HCM system lie in its ability to provide a more strategic approach to HR management. It helps in attracting and retaining top talent, improving employee engagement and productivity, and aligning HR strategies with business objectives. Additionally, HCM systems offer robust analytics for informed decision-making and future planning, thereby supporting the overall growth and competitiveness of the organization.

How to Choose HR Software?

Choosing the right HR Software is a crucial decision that significantly impacts your organization's human resource department's efficiency and effectiveness. Choose an HR Solution that fits what your business needs and aims to do. This way, the software you choose will help make your HR tasks better and also match well with your company's main plans.

Core HR

Core HR consists of basic HR functions like employee data management, payroll, benefits administration, compliance management, and HR reporting. It forms the backbone of HR operations, centralizing essential data and processes. These functionalities ensure efficient management of basic HR tasks.

Core HR software streamlines critical administrative tasks, reduces errors, ensures compliance with regulations, and provides accessible data for strategic decision-making. This efficiency directly supports HR professionals and enhances overall company operations.

Recruitment (Applicant Tracking System)

An Applicant Tracking System (ATS) is a software tool that automates the recruitment process. It assists in managing job postings, collecting applications, screening candidates, and tracking the hiring process.

Key functionalities include job posting distribution, resume parsing, candidate tracking, communication tools, and reporting analytics. These enable efficient management of the recruitment process from start to finish.

ATS streamlines the recruitment process, improves candidate experience, reduces time-to-hire, and aids in acquiring the best talent. It also provides analytics for better decision-making in recruitment strategies.

Onboarding and Offboarding

Onboarding is when you help a new employee start working in your company, and offboarding is the organized way you say goodbye to an employee who is leaving. HR Software must contain these types of features as it automates task management, electronic document management, training and developmentment for onboarding, and exit interviews, and data retention for offboarding.

Effective onboarding and offboarding HR system ensure a smooth transition for employees, enhance engagement, and maintain continuity. It also safeguards company data and provides insights into workforce dynamics.

Employee Self-Service (ESS)

An HR Software must have ESS as it allows employees to access and manage their personal HR-related information like payroll, benefits, and personal data, fostering a more direct engagement with their HR data. Key features include access to personal and payroll information, benefits management, time-off requests, and document uploading capabilities. ESS empowers employees by giving them control over their information, reduces HR administrative workload, and improves data accuracy and employee satisfaction.

Time and Attendance

Time and attendance systems track employee work hours, while PTO (Paid Time Off) management handles employee leave requests and approvals. Important features that the right HR Software should include are time tracking, leave request and approval processes, holiday calendars, and integration with payroll systems. These systems enhance workforce management efficiency, ensure accurate payroll processing, and help maintain compliance with labor laws.

Employee Engagement Software

Employee engagement software is designed to enhance employee satisfaction and engagement through feedback, recognition, and communication tools. Key functionalities include surveys, feedback tools, recognition and rewards systems, and communication platforms. This software improves employee morale, encourages a positive workplace culture, and provides valuable insights into employee satisfaction, leading to higher productivity and retention.

Learning Management System (LMS)

A Learning Management System (LMS) is a platform for delivering, tracking, and managing training and development programs within an organization. Essential features include course creation and management, tracking learner progress, assessment tools, and reporting analytics. An LMS facilitates continuous learning and skill development, aligns employee growth with organizational goals, and tracks the effectiveness of training programs.

Performance Review

A performance review is a regular evaluation of an employee's job performance and overall contribution to the organization. Key features include goal setting and tracking, feedback mechanisms, performance appraisal forms, and review cycle management. Performance review software standardizes evaluations, provides actionable feedback, and aids in identifying areas for employee development, ultimately driving organizational growth.

Integration and Customization

Integration means the HR software can easily work together with other systems in your business. Customization means changing the software to fit your company's specific needs. Key things to look for are how well it works with systems you already have if you can change how it looks and works, and if it can grow with your business. When your HR software can integrate and be customized, it makes everything run smoother, solves specific problems you have, and changes as your business changes.

Data Security

Data security involves protecting sensitive information from unauthorized access, corruption, or theft. Data Security is crucial in safeguarding employee and company data. Key features include encryption, access controls, regular security audits, and compliance with data protection regulations.

These ensure that personal and financial information remains confidential and secure. Robust data security in HR software protects against data breaches, maintains employee trust, and ensures legal compliance, thereby safeguarding both the employees' personal information and the company's reputation.

How much will HR software cost?

Most of the SaaS-based (Software as a Service) HR Software cost is based on the workforce in the organization. It might cost you from $2 to $18 per employee per month. Also make sure to add implementation, migration, or any other hidden cost that can vary from $500 all the way to $4,000.

Based on the pricing we have shared compare the HR software reputation, features, and level of support that the vendor is ready to provide you. By exploring different options, you will be able to negotiate with potential vendors.

Make sure you are not limiting yourself to the available budget. Think of parameters such as reducing manual tasks, cutting labor costs, time savings, risk reductions, and improving HR and employee productivity. Also, consider other factors such as scalability and migration to another HRIS software if things don’t work out which can help your organization in the future.

Most importantly, pay serious attention to terms and conditions. As some of the vendors might tie you with a couple of years’ contract that can result In penalties if the contract is terminated before the end date.

Selection of HR Software in 10 Steps!

Choosing the right HR system is a critical decision for any organization looking to streamline its human resource management processes.

This comprehensive guide outlines the steps you should follow to ensure that you select a system that not only fits your current needs but also adapts to future growth and changes.

From assessing your requirements to ensuring legal compliance, each step is designed to help you make an informed decision that will enhance your HR operations and improve employee satisfaction.

Choose HR Software: 10 steps

1. Assess Your Needs

Start by conducting a thorough assessment of your organization’s HR needs. Determine which HR functions require support, such as recruitment, payroll processing, employee performance management, or benefits administration. This will help you pinpoint the specific features your HR software must have.

To better understand what you require from HR software, reflect on these questions about your daily HR challenges and goals.

  • What HR functions are we struggling to manage efficiently?
  • How could new software enhance these functions?
  • What specific features do we need in HR software to address our current challenges?
  • Which HR processes are the most time-consuming and could benefit from automation?

2. Set a Budget

Establish a budget that reflects the size and financial capacity of your organization. Consider not only the initial cost of the software but also ongoing expenses such as updates, maintenance, and additional module integrations.

Before diving into options, consider these financial aspects to ensure the HR software fits within your budget,

  • What is our budget for HR software?
  • Are there any hidden costs, such as for installation, training, or additional modules?
  • What is the expected return on investment (ROI) from implementing this software?

3. Consider Scalability

Choose software that can scale as your business grows. The system should be able to handle an increasing number of employees and more complex HR tasks without significant upgrades or replacements.

Scalability is key for future growth. Ponder these questions to gauge how well potential software can adapt to your evolving needs.

  • Will the HR software grow with our business?
  • How easy is it to add more users or integrate additional features as our needs evolve?

4. Check for Integration Capabilities

The HR software should integrate seamlessly with your existing business systems, such as accounting software, customer relationship management (CRM) systems, and other operational tools. Integration capabilities minimize data silos and streamline workflows.

Integration with existing systems simplifies processes. These questions will help you determine the integration capabilities of your prospective HR software.

  • Can the HR software integrate seamlessly with our existing systems and tools?
  • What is involved in integrating these systems?

5. Evaluate Features and Functionality

List all the features that are critical for your HR operations and ensure the software you consider meets these requirements. Prioritize essential features like user-friendliness, mobile access, and customizability according to your specific needs.

To find software that truly meets your needs, focus on these critical functionalities and features.

  • Which features are must-haves versus nice-to-haves?
  • Does the software offer comprehensive analytics and reporting tools?
  • How user-friendly is the interface?

6. Read Reviews and Testimonials

Look at reviews and testimonials from other users, especially those in similar industries or company sizes. This can provide valuable insights into the software’s performance, reliability, and customer support quality.

Learning from existing users offers invaluable insights. Reflect on these points when reviewing testimonials.

  • What do other users say about the software’s reliability and customer support?
  • Are there common issues that users encounter with this software?

7. Request Demos and Trials

Before making a final decision, request demos and free trials to test the software’s functionality. This step is crucial to see how the software fits into your daily operations and if it meets your expectations in real-time use.

Experience the software firsthand. These questions will guide what to look for during demos and trials.

  • Can we access a free trial to test the software’s functionality?
  • During the demo, what specific areas should we focus on to ensure the software meets our needs?

8. Analyze Support and Customer Service

Consider the type and availability of customer support offered. Reliable customer service and technical support are crucial for troubleshooting and helping your team make the most of the HR software.

Support can be a dealbreaker. Consider these aspects to understand the quality of customer service you can expect.

  • What type of customer support does the software vendor offer (e.g., 24/7, live chat, phone support)?
  • How responsive and knowledgeable is the support team?

9. Review Security Features

Ensure the HR software has robust security protocols to protect sensitive employee data. Check for features like data encryption, secure data storage, and compliance with regulations such as GDPR or SOC 2 Type 2, if applicable.

Security is paramount in protecting sensitive data. Ensure the software's safety measures with these inquiries.

  • What security measures does the software have in place to protect sensitive data?
  • Is the software compliant with relevant data protection regulations (e.g., GDPR, SOC 2 Type 2)?

10. Consider Compliance

The HR software must comply with all relevant employment laws and regulations in your region. This includes features for reporting, tax filing, and compliance tracking to keep your business in line with legal requirements.

Compliance with legal standards is essential. Use these questions to verify that the HR software meets regulatory requirements.

  • Does the software help us comply with local and international HR laws?
  • Can the software generate compliance reports needed for audits?